Therapy for children and young people aims to provide support with social, emotional or behavioural concerns. Children and Young People's Therapists have specialist knowledge, skills and training to work with the client group. Cognitive analytical therapy. This is an example of an Integrative approach.

WebJan 25, 2024 · Holistic mental health therapy. Holistic psychotherapy, sometimes referred to as holistic therapy, is a type of psychotherapy (talk therapy) that considers and treats the whole person, including their mind, body, spirit, and emotions. 1 Other methods and non-traditional therapies are often used as part of holistic therapy alongside talk therapy.
